It must be underscored that the
Irob Ethiopians wished to remain Ethiopians and that fact was part of
the reason, in addition to a desire by Mr. Zenawi to establish an
international boundary within Ethiopia, that led to the 1998 wars between the
EPLF and Ethiopia. The 1998 senseless wars that resulted in the killing
of tens of thousands of Ethiopians was used by Mr. Zenawi and Mr.
Afeworki to arrive at the 2000 Algiers agreement that is claimed to have
offered a framework for establishing an international boundary, though
that agreement unjustly resuscitated defunct and voided conventions. Those
1900, 1902, 1908 defunct and voided conventions were used by a five man
EEBC (Eritrea-Ethiopia Boundary Commission) to delivered an unjust but
legal-sounding international boundary de novo between a “state called
Eritrea” that did not exist before 1889, and Ethiopia within which
the region, that Italy called Eritrea, was a part for thousands of years.
Only eleven years of military occupation by Italy was the rationale for
founding an international boundary within Ethiopia. Beyond
resuscitating conventions that were expressly abrogated by Italy, the 2002 EEBC
document invented a history of Ethiopia to extend the number of years that
the coastal region was not governed by Ethiopia. The commissioners were
wrong as Ras Alula killed about 500 soldiers in Dogali, only 19
kilometres from Massawa that Italians had occupied and from which they were
sending soldiers to support their fort in Saati. Later, Emperor Yohannes
IV camped for a month near Saati in 1887 about 26 kilometres from
Massawa to attack the Italians, though he decided to engage the Dervish in
Metema at which he was killed. It was in the wake of the Emperor march
to Gojjam and then to Metema that the Italians ascended from the coastal
plains to the Ethiopian highlands.
Their further encroachment past
River Mereb was stopped as Italian soldiers were routed in the battle of
Adwa of 1896. Italy signed the Treaty of 1896 in which they agreed not to
cede to any other power any part of Ethiopia that they will
administrate. The 1900, 1902, 1908 conventions are related to the root Treaty of
1896. Menelik II had predicted that the colonials will leave. Indeed,
the Italians left, and actually in 1947 they abrogated any treaties that
empowered them to have possessions over Ethiopia. The EEBC document has
